“When I first saw the #ultrasound images of my kids, I saw the future of my family,” she said. “When I see the ultrasound images of these #abalone, I see the future of an entire species.” Dr. @KristinAquilino in @NYTScience
@NYTScience
NYT Science
4 years
A new study uses noninvasive ultrasound to determine which abalone will be reproductive. The technique could raise the prospects of successful captive breeding efforts and ultimately help restore endangered abalone in the wild.

Have you ever seen an ultrasound of an #abalone? An #ultrasound transducer can be used to quickly and noninvasively detect when abalone are ready to spawn, minimizing handling and stress for the animal. Read more from @ucdavis news: https://t.co/rCoBULQ6QB 1/3
